Goldstone is the location of the Deep Space Network, the most powerful radio transmitter on Earth.
Fiction
[edit]Regeneration One
[edit]Having been shot out of the sky above a devastated Earth by Megatron, Springer had Roadbuster, Leadfoot, and Sandstorm run interference with Megatron's zombies while he, Kup, and Whirl made for Goldstone to send a message back to Cybertron warning Optimus Prime and the other Autobots. Loose Ends, Part 2 Although the signal successfully reached Cybertron, Megatron revealed that he had left the Deep Space Network intact and allowed the Wreckers to reach it as his plan had been to get Prime's attention all along.
